If you consider high losing scores to be an indication of tough matches, consider this:

Of the 9875 matches that were played in 2014, the six highest "unpenalized" losing scores occurred during eliminations on Archimedes:

265: SF 1-1, 1477/2590/1625 to 51/2485/1918 (Raw score 285 to 315)
260: QF 1-3, 399/2056/2175 to 51/2485/1918 (Raw score 260 to 315)
256: QF 1-1, 399/2056/2175 to 51/2485/1918 (Raw score 256 to 390)


(Data derived from a spreadsheet that "Ether" posted in the "High Score 2014" thread showing match data for all competitions all season long)
